您好,欢迎访问三七文档
当前位置:首页 > 商业/管理/HR > 咨询培训 > 硬件工程师培训教程(三)
精品资料网()25万份精华管理资料,2万多集管理视频讲座精品资料网()专业提供企管培训资料硬件工程师培训教程(三)第一节CPU的历史CPU从最初发展至今已经有20多年的历史了,这期间,按照其处理信息的字长,CPU可以分为4位微处理器、8位微处理器、16位微处理器、32位微处理器以及64位微处理器等等。在风起云涌的IT业界,PC机CPU厂商主要以Intel、AMD和VIA(威盛)三家为主,我们将以他们的产品为介绍重点。一、Intel阵营Intel(英特尔)公司大家已经是如雷贯耳,不管你是否为计算机高手,也不管你是否是业内人士,只要你知道计算机这个词,对Intel就一定不会陌生。Intel是全世界硬件行业的老大,是世界上最大的芯片生产商和制造商。提到Intel公司就不能不谈谈IntelCPU芯片的发展历程。按照国际上目前比较能够得到业内认同的说法,Intel的CPU芯片主要经历了以下几个发展阶段:1.Intel40041971年,Intel公司推出了世界上第一款微处理器4004。这是第一个用于个人计算机的4位微处理器,它包含2300个晶体管,由于性能很差,市场反应冷淡。2.Intel8080/8085在4004之后,Intel公司又研制出了8080处理器和8085处理器,加上当时美国Motorola公司的MC6800微处理器和Zilog公司的Z80微处理器,一起组成了8位微处理器家族。3.Intel8086/808816微处理器的典型产品是Intel公司的8086微处理器,以及同时生产出的数学协处理器,即8087。这两种芯片使用互相兼容的指令集,但在8087指令集中增加了一些专门用于对数、指数和三角函数等数学计算的指令。由于这些指令应用于8086和8087,因此被人们统称为x86指令集。此后Intel推出新一代CPU产品均兼容原来的x86指令集。1979年Intel公司推出了8086的简化版——8088芯片,它仍是16位微处理器,内含29000个晶体管,时钟频率为4.77MHz,地址总线为20位,可以使用1MB内存。8088的内部数据总线是16位,外部数据总线是8位。1981年,8088芯片被首次用于IBMPC机当中,开创了个人电脑的新时代。如果说8080处理器还不为大多数人所熟知的话,那么8088则可以说是家喻户晓了,PC(个人电脑)机的第一代CPU便是从它开始的。4.Intel802861982年的Intel80286虽然是16位芯片,但是其内部已包含了13.4万个晶体管,时钟频率也到了前所未有的20MHz。其内、外部数据总线均为16位,地址总线为24位,可以使用16MB内存,工作方式包括实模式和保护模式两种。5.Intel80386DX/80386SX32位微处理器的代表产品首推Intel公司1985年推出的80386,这是一种全32位微处理器芯片,也是x86家族中第一款32位芯片,其内部包含了27.5万个晶体管,时钟频率为12.5MHz,后逐步提高到33MHz。80386的内部和外部数据总线都是32位,地址总线也是32位,可以寻址到4GB内存。它除了具有实模式和保护模式以外,还增加了一种虚拟386的工作方式,可以通过同时模拟多个8086处理器来提供多任务能力。1989年,Intel公司又推出准32位处理器芯片80386SX。它的内部数据总线为32位,与80386相同,外部数据总线为16位。也就是说,80386SX的内部处理速度与80386接近,也支持真正的多任务操作,并且可以使用为80286开发的输入/输出接口芯片。80386SX的性能优于80286,而价格只及80386的1/3。386处理器没有内置数学协处理器,因此不能执行浮点运算指令,如果需要进行浮点运算,必须额外购买昂贵的80387数学协处理器。精品资料网()25万份精华管理资料,2万多集管理视频讲座精品资料网()专业提供企管培训资料6.Intel80486DX/80486SX1989年,80486处理器面市,它集成了125万个晶体管,时钟频率由25MHz逐步提升到33MHz、40MHz和50MHz。80486内含80386和数字协处理器80387以及一个8KB的高速缓存,并在x86系列中首次使用了RISC(精简指令集)技术,可以在一个时钟周期内执行一条指令。它还采用了突发总线方式,大大提高了与内存的数据交换速度。由于这些改进,80486的性能比带有80387数学协处理器的80386提高了4倍。早期的486理器分为有数学协处理器的486DX和无数学协处理器的486SX两种,其价格也相差许多。随着芯片技术的不断发,CPU的频率越来越快,而PC机外部设备受工艺限制,能够承受的工作频率有限,这就阻碍了CPU主频的进一步提高,在这种情况下,出现了CPU倍频技术,该技术使CPU内部工作频率为处理器外频的2~3倍,486DX2、486DX4的名字便是由此而来。以后的日子里,CPU开始了突飞猛进的发展。7.IntelPentiumClassic(经典奔腾)代号:P54C发布时间:1993年核心频率:60~200MHz总线频率:50~66MHz工作电压:3.3V制造工艺:0.8~0.35μm晶体管数目:310~330万个芯片面积:191mm2缓存容量:16KBL1Cache指令内置:x86指令集、x86译码器、80位浮点单元接口类型:Socket7早期的Pentium处理器(主要是Pentium60和Pentium66)存在浮点运算错误的问题,Intel为此花4亿美元回收了大批有问题的CPU,这在当时是十分冒险的行为,但Intel的这一做法最终赢得了用户的信任,Pentium再度成为市场上最畅销的产品。8.IntelPentiumPro(高能奔腾)代号:P6发布时间:1995年核心频率:150~200MHz总线频率:60~66MHz工作电压:3.1V/3.3V制造工艺:0.5~0.35μm晶体管数目:550~700万个芯片面积:196mm2缓存容量:16KBL1Cache、256KB/512KB/1MBL2Cache指令内置:x86指令集、x86译码器、80位浮点单元、分支预测功能接口类型:Socket89.IntelPentiumMMX代号:P55C发布时间:1997年精品资料网()25万份精华管理资料,2万多集管理视频讲座精品资料网()专业提供企管培训资料核心频率:166~233MHz总线频率:60~66MHz内核电压:2.8VI/O电压:3.3V制造工艺:0.35μm晶体管数目:450万个芯片面积:128mm2缓存容量:32KBL1Cache指令内置:x86指令集、x86译码器、80位浮点单元、MMX多媒体指令集接口类型:Socket7PentiumMMX有16KB数据缓存、16KB指令缓存和4路写缓存,并增加了从PentiumPro而来的分支预测单元和从Cyrix6x86而来的返回堆栈技术。新增的57条MMX指令用来处理音频、视频和图像数据,使CPU在多媒体应用上的能力大大增强。10.IntelPentiumⅡ代号:Klamath(1997年上市)、Deschutes(1998年上市)核心频率:233~333MHz(66MHz外频)、350~450MHz(100MHz外频)总线频率:66~100MHz制造工艺:0.35(Klamath)/0.25(Deschutes)μm核心电压:2.8V(Klamath)/2.0V(Deschutes)晶体管数目:750万个芯片面积:130.9mm2缓存容量:32KBL1Cache、512KBL2Cache接口类型:Slot1PentiumⅡ是在PentiumPro的基础上将内置的L2Cache移出,与CPU焊在同一块电路板上,然后封装成卡匣形式而成。外置L2Cache的容量为512KB,以CPU速度的一半运行。11.IntelCeleron(赛扬)代号:Covington发布时间:1998年核心频率:266~300MHz总线频率:66MHz制造工艺:0.25μm晶体管数目:750万个芯片面积:153.9mm2缓存容量:32KBL1Cache接口类型:Slot112.IntelCeleronMendocino(新赛扬)代号:Mendocino发布时间:1998年核心频率:300~533MHz总线频率:66MHz精品资料网()25万份精华管理资料,2万多集管理视频讲座精品资料网()专业提供企管培训资料制造工艺:0.25μm晶体管数目:1900万个芯片面积:153.9mm2缓存容量:32KBL1Cache、128KBL2Cache接口类型:Slot1、Socket370由于具有和PentiumⅡ一样的核心,所以Celeron的浮点能力依然强劲,在游戏和3D图形处理方面与PentiumⅡ一样出色。但没有了L2Cache,Celeron的整数性能大打折扣,Celeron266的整数运算能力甚至还不及PentiumMMX233,在与K6-2的争斗中一败涂地。所以Intel又加入了128KB全速L2Cache,此为新赛扬。新赛扬只有128KBL2Cache,虽然比起PentiumⅡ的512KB少得多,但其性能并不比PentiumⅡ差。因为新赛扬的缓存速度与CPU核心频率相同,而PentiumⅡ的缓存速度只有CPU核心频率的一半。正因为如此,新赛扬不但具有同频PentiumⅡ的高性能,并且具有很强的超频能力,部分300MHzCeleronA能超到令人吃惊的504MHz甚至更高。13.IntelPentiumⅢ代号:Katmai、Coppermine发布时间:1999年核心频率:450MHz以上总线频率:100~133MHzCPU核心电压:1.8V制造工艺:0.25(Katmai)/0.18(Coppermine)μm晶体管数目:950万个芯片面积:153.9mm2缓存容量:32KBL1Cache、512KBL2Cache指令内置:MMX指令集和SSE指令集PentiumⅢ处理器增加了70条SSE指令,并具有惟一的处理器序列号。
本文标题:硬件工程师培训教程(三)
链接地址:https://www.777doc.com/doc-983756 .html